Invest storage Unit building Question
I have been wanting to get into some sort of real estate investment for some time. I have a cooworker who is moving to be closer to her children and her and her husband plan to sell a large building for about $100,000. It has 20 units. Its on a cement slab. Has a heated shop at one end with bathroom and sink. Each unit rented out for $50 with a waiting list.
So this would equal $1000 per month. I've seen things about the 2% rule and this comes out to be 1% out of $100,000.
I'm just wondering about any recommendations. Thought that maybe with the smaller percent could still be worth it since it may not have the potential problems that residential tenants would.
